<p>Are prospective CC transfer students at a big disadavantage when applying to selective schools? would a 4.0 from a from a top 50ish school be much more likely to get a thick envelope than a 4.0 from a community college, all else being equal? Do places like Cornell and UVA accept community college students who aren’t in their ‘articulation’ agreement?</p>

<p>prospective cc transfer students are by no means at any disadvantage, provided you are taking a rigorous program at the cc and not skating by. in fact, oftentimes a cc student will get in over an equally qualified 4 year transfer app, esp a top 50 4 year transfer app, due to the fact that the cc student has more reason to need to transfer and brings someone who normally would not have been at that school to it.</p>
